Sulfoximines: A Reusable Directing Group for Chemo‐ and Regioselective <i>ortho</i> CH Oxidation of Arenes

Abstract

Sulfoximines direct: a new protocol for the chemo- and regioselective ortho C-H acetoxylation of arenes in N-benzoylated sulfoximines is reported. The sulfoximine directing group is easily detached from the C-H oxidation product through acid-promoted hydrolysis, isolated, and reused. The meta-substituted phenols are synthesized following this strategy and the stereointegrity of the sulfoximine is preserved in this transformation. C(sp(3))-H acetoxylation of the methyl group is also demonstrated.
